Lend A Helping Hand is a not-for-profit, 501(c)3 organization that assists organizations, families, and loved ones with fund-raising activities. The organization's mission is to help people faced with a catastrophic illness pay for uninsured medical treatment. Lend A Helping Hand partners with families and loved ones to raise money and awareness within a community. We have helped children, organizations, and adults raise money for bone marrow transplants, organ transplants, surgeries, chemotherapy, and ongoing medical treatment.
